Steps to reproduce:

Opened Preferences and disabled "accept cookies", then opened a newtab via "+"-Button and entered a website.

This is a fresh firefox 43.0.4 x86 stable installation on windows 10 x64, but was a problem since i first clean-installed windows 10 on this machine. I tested this without any additional changes or addons installed.


Actual results:

If the website is for example "www.der-betze-brennt.de" the duplicate tab CRTL+mousedrag does not work on this tab. This also happens on pages like "moonsault.de" or "tvtv.de" but not on "t-online.de" or "ebay.de" (just some random sites from my favorites). The "extended history" via right-mouse on back-button does not appear either on this tab.

If i re-enable cookies, the still opened tabs work as expected. Re-disabling does not effect the opened tab, but the weird problem explained above affects any additional tabs.


Expected results:

CTRL+Mousedrag should duplicate tabs, like always. The "extended history" via right-mouse on back-button should appear.
